**Weekend Lift Maintenance — New Starters**

Lifts at Corvane House are serviced Saturdays 06:00–12:00. Both cars are locked out; use Stairwell B. Maintenance crew from Hollis Vertical signs in at the loading dock, not reception. Never override a lift lockout. If a car is stuck between floors, call the duty engineer and wait. Stairwell B stays badge-locked on weekends, so you'll need the pass code below.

turnstile pass: bdg-R-53

# Artifact signing — Hotplate config reloader

Hotplate hot-reloads config without restarts. Every reloaded bundle must be signed; unsigned bundles are rejected at the watcher. Review checklist: bundle version bumped, checksum matches manifest, signature verifies against the active key. Do not approve PRs that bypass the verifier flag. Rotation happens quarterly; stale keys fail closed. Reload events are logged to the Kestrelline audit stream. For verification during review, the currently active signing key is shown below.

deploy key for kajof-fajop: bky6_gDHw9Q

Runbook: Scanline barcode bridge

If warehouse scans stop flowing into Cartwheel, it's almost always the bridge service on the Dunmore floor box wedging after a USB hiccup. Bounce the service first — nine times out of ten that fixes it. If not, check the queue depth before escalating. When restarting, make sure the bridge comes up with these settings.

deployment values, yafop-bajef:
[gilok]
team = ulaius
access_code = ac_423664
host = gilok.sivrelhq.corp
port = 9200
owner = pelius.istax
peer = eliok.torvasoft.internal